Well, I'm still strugling with Oracle ;-)
 
When I open an Oracle table in MapInfo, and stores a tab file on disk, it look 
like this:
 
*************************
!table
!version 550
!charset WindowsLatin1
Definition Table
  Type ODBC
begin_metadata
"\IsReadOnly" = "FALSE"
"\DATALINK" = ""
"\DATALINK\Query" = "Select * From CMIS.CMIS_PARCELS Where INSTR('ORG CURR', 
STATUS) > 0"
"\DATALINK\ConnectionString" = "SRVR=tnt;UID=drs"
"\DATALINK\ToolKit" = "ORAINET"
"\CACHE" = "OFF"
"\MBRSEARCH" = "ON"
end_metadata
***********************
The thing that bugs me is that it writes the uid into the file. I would have it 
using the availeble connection, because when a different user opens this table 
afterwards he is propted for the password for the user 'drs'. This new user of 
course could enter his own username/password, but he already has established a 
connection to Oracle, so I just want MapInfo to use this connection.
 
Any ideas how this can be established, or does every user just have to have 
their tables locally, in the temp folder for instance ?
